Pierre Boaistuau, also known as Pierre Launay or Sieur de Launay (c. 1517, Nantes – 1566, Paris), was a French Renaissance humanist writer, author of a number of popularizing compilations and discourses on various subjects. Pierre Boaistuau, dit Pierre Launay, né en 1517 à Nantes, mort en 1566 à Paris, était un compilateur, traducteur et écrivain français. WebPierre Boaistuau adapted into French six Bandello novellas that would become, in William Painter’s translation, a source for Shakespeare’s Romeo and Juliet. As the first English …
